All signs point toward robust military training at the Michigan National Guard’s Camp Grayling Maneuver Center, Mich., Jan. 27, 2021. Camp Grayling and the nearby Alpena Combat Readiness Training Center serve as the focal point for the annual Northern Strike series of training exercises, which includes both a summer and a winter iteration. The Northern Strike exercise series offers the Michigan National Guard’s unparalleled facilities as a venue for U.S. and coalition forces to receive advanced All-Domain joint fires training in all weather conditions.
